The history dates back to the era of the Mahabharata. The idol is believed to be the same one originally worshipped by Krishna's wife, Rukmini. Later, a devotee named Bodana Bhatt used to walk to Dwarka every six months to worship the idol. When he became too old to walk, legend says Lord Krishna asked him to bring the idol to his village. This act of moving the deity to the village gave Dakor its sacred status.
